What speed is used to determine the taper length according to the regulations?

The correct choice is based on the guideline that the taper length for traffic control setups should be determined using the off-peak 85th percentile speed. This measurement reflects a speed at which the majority of drivers feel comfortable traveling under good conditions when traffic is lighter. By using the 85th percentile speed, traffic control designs ensure that taper lengths are adequate for the majority of drivers, promoting safety as well as compliance with posted speed limits.

Using this speed is significant because it takes into account typical driving behaviors during periods of reduced traffic, contrasting with factors like average speed or max speed, which may be influenced by other conditions and could lead to a taper design that does not facilitate smooth traffic flow. The posted speed limit, while important, does not always accurately reflect driver behavior in real-world conditions, especially during off-peak times. Thus, applying the 85th percentile speed allows for a more functional and driver-centric approach in the design of taper lengths.
